Chemical Classification

Within industrial chemical nomenclature, nootropics span multiple chemical classifications including pyrrolidone derivatives (racetams), peptide compounds, choline analogues, amino acid derivatives, and other molecular structures of biochemical research interest. This diverse classification encompasses chemically related substances employed within neurochemical research, biochemical analysis, molecular pharmacology studies, and scientific investigation. The structural diversity within this category—including compounds such as piracetam, aniracetam, oxiracetam, pramiracetam, noopept, and related molecules—defines varied chemical behaviours, handling requirements, and application contexts within professional laboratory and research environments. Racetam Compounds

Pyrrolidone derivative compounds including piracetam, aniracetam, oxiracetam, pramiracetam, and related racetam structures serve as research subjects within biochemical and neurochemical investigation programmes. These compounds offer specific molecular characteristics valued for structure-activity relationship studies and analytical research.

Peptide-Based Compounds

Peptide-derived nootropic compounds including noopept and related peptide structures provide research materials for biochemical investigation, molecular analysis, and pharmaceutical development programmes requiring peptide chemistry expertise and handling protocols.

Choline Derivatives

Choline analogue compounds including alpha-GPC, citicoline (CDP-choline), and related cholinergic research materials serve biochemical research programmes investigating cholinergic pathways, neurochemical mechanisms, and molecular pharmacology.
